Had driven by this little cafe on many occasions and finally decided to stop for lunch. What a great choice. Menu is by no means exhaustive with three very distinct offerings of pizza, sandwich (with salad) and salads (can add protein). Good selection of coffee, tea, cold drinks. The desert menu is to die for, all made in house. Great value for money and a definite must visit.

The coffee and food (traditional pastries) are sourced from Italy and although not cheap are very good. For a small discussion meeting or midday refuel it takes some beating. Lovely lady that owns it is very focussed on quality and service.
